    Standard practice at the time, as far as I know. The Board of Trade regarded a single line railway as an uncompleted railway - hence having to purchase sufficient land for a double track line. Building double track bridges wouldn't cost much more than single track ones, at least for the scale of bridge works on the Mid Hants. (It might have been a different story if any viaducts had been necessary.) In contrast, excavating cuttings and tipping embankments to double track size would have been a huge increase in cost.

    I suspect that the BoT view may have changed with time.
    The West Highland is a bit of an anomaly in that (as I believe it) the land was given to the NBR by the lairds with the condition that it would be returned if the line closed. It was also opened unfenced, with a 40 mph speed limit as a quid pro quo.

    The Mid Hants LROs of 1977 and 1985 both specifically forbid the use of electric traction (unless self-generated or battery). I would imagine that there is a similar provision in Bluebell, Swanage, &c. LROs.
